These are wired in-ear monitors with a dynamic driver and sound isolation, designed for musicians needing a secure fit and replaceable cables on a budget.
The M6 PRO offers a strong fit due to its flexible memory wire earhooks that conform to the ear and seven included pairs of eartips, including Comply foam, ensuring a personalized and secure seal. This design prevents them from falling out during activity and is crucial for the sound isolation feature to function effectively.

Buying Guide
When looking at in-ear monitors like these, you're primarily buying for a specific sound profile and a secure fit, often for stage use or active lifestyles. Unlike consumer earbuds, the focus here is on accurate sound reproduction and noise isolation, not necessarily a 'fun' or bass-heavy sound. The fit is paramount because a poor seal drastically degrades sound quality, especially bass. You'll want to pay attention to the included accessories, as replaceable cables and a variety of ear tips significantly extend the life and usability of the product.
Dynamic Driver
This refers to the type of speaker inside the earbud. A dynamic driver, like a miniature traditional speaker, uses a coil and diaphragm to produce sound. It's known for delivering a fuller, more impactful bass response compared to other driver types, which is important for feeling the rhythm in music.
Sound Isolation
This isn't active noise cancellation, but rather a passive blocking of outside sound. Think of it like earplugs: the better the physical seal in your ear canal, the less outside noise gets in. This allows you to hear your audio more clearly at lower, safer volumes, which is crucial for musicians on stage or anyone in a noisy environment.
Replaceable Cables
The cable is often the first part of wired headphones to fail from wear and tear. Having replaceable cables means you don't have to buy a whole new set of headphones if a cable breaks; you just swap it out. This significantly extends the lifespan of your investment, similar to replacing a worn-out tire on a bicycle instead of buying a new bike.
Memory Wire Earhooks
These are wires built into the cable near the earbud that you can bend and shape to fit snugly around the back of your ear. This ensures the earbuds stay securely in place, even during vigorous movement, preventing them from falling out during a performance or workout. It's like having custom-fitted glasses that won't slip off your face.
